October is here, and that means it's Foster Families Month in Saskatchewan! This special month gives us a chance to celebrate the incredible foster families who open their hearts and homes to children in need.

As Social Services Minister Terry Jenson said, foster families demonstrate unwavering love and commitment. They don't just provide shelter; they offer children a brighter future filled with hope and stability.

Foster Families Month is also a great opportunity to highlight the amazing work of the Saskatchewan Foster Families Association (SFFA). This organization supports foster parents by providing resources and guidance, helping them create nurturing environments for children. Whether it's transitioning through school, attending medical appointments, or reconnecting with biological families, SFFA is there every step of the way.

Executive Director Deb Davies emphasizes the crucial role foster families play in children’s lives, bringing love and stability not just to the kids, but also to the entire community. Their tireless efforts help shape a better environment for our youth, and for that, we are incredibly grateful.
